Let's talk

We’re a global team of experienced professionals based in four countries, and working with clients in many more. Virtual working is our norm, has been for 10 years now, and we’re proof that you don’t need to be in one building or even one country to work well as a closely knit team. But Fresh HQ is in the UK, so if you’re in London and fancy meeting up, give us a shout and we’ll put the kettle on.

+44 (0) 20 7101 0797

118 Pall Mall | London | SW1Y 5ED